  • No wait on a holiday weekend for brunch? Is that a bad sign. The Wynn, Bacchanal, and Wicked spoon all had lines on normal weekends. Maybe just the timing, right? Maybe not. While the food wasn't horrible, it was Station Casino standard. For a nice, upscale hotel like this, the food quality was inexcusable. What made matters worse is that the organization of the food was incomprehensible. I got my waterlogged snow crab and went in search of cocktail sauce, lemon and melted butter. The butter was by the cereal and the lemon and cocktail sauce was over by the sushi along with the waterlogged shrimp. I got a slice of prime rib that turned out to be stringy and tough. Where was the au jus and mashed potatoes and creamed spinach? The au jus was across the room on the same table as the maple syrup. I kid you not, a lady almost accidentally put au jus on her pancakes that were by the mashed potatoes I had been searching for. I later found cheese blintzes and strawberry sauce over by the baked fish and the fruit over by the sushi and cheese and Caesar salad. The green salad was by the carving station and the mixed salads were on the opposite side of the buffet. The last search was for whipped cream for my cobbler. I looked everywhere before finally asking a lady who waved vaguely at the desserts. I walked around and saw none. I asked the one lady behind the desserts and she brought a tray out from the refrigerator and scooped me up a serving. I got back to the table and found that it was unsweetened. It's sad that the best thing I had to eat was the mixed green salad I made with crumbled blue cheese, balsamic dressing and sunflower seeds. The parmesan crisps were good too. I'm not a picky eater either. It was a humorously frustrating experience. It became a scavenger hunt to find anything. Really Bellagio?
